When non-motor components of LiftMaster gate openers falter, they frequently present specific symptoms. For example, a failing logic board can lead to erratic operation, incorrect opening/closing sequences, or a total lack of response, often signaled by specific error codes. Common culprits for gates refusing to close or reversing without warning are issues with safety sensors, especially photo-eyes, which can be affected by misalignment, dirt, or wiring damage.

Furthermore, we are skilled in rectifying problems with the opener's mechanical linkages, including worn chains, frayed belts, or compromised pivot arms, which can result in jerky motion or the gate binding. Proper adjustment and lubrication of these elements are paramount for fluid operation and to prevent excessive strain on the motor and delicate control board. If your LiftMaster gate opener randomly activates, closes, or halts unexpectedly mid-cycle, this inconsistent behavior frequently indicates problems with the control board, radio signal interference, or malfunctioning limit switches, necessitating a detailed electronic troubleshooting.
When your LiftMaster remote controls suddenly become unresponsive or experience a significant loss of operating range, the issue can stem from depleted batteries, a damaged remote, external signal interference, or a faulty receiver module inside the gate opener's control housing.
A gate that consistently fails to close, or reverses without any apparent obstruction, typically points to issues with the safety photo-eyes. These critical LiftMaster components are often affected by misalignment, accumulated debris, or physical damage, compromising the gate's safety features.
If your LiftMaster gate reverses direction without any visible object in its path, this often signals a problem with the safety reverse sensors – including pressure-sensitive edges or photo-eyes – or incorrect force settings on the control board. This critical safety flaw demands prompt professional intervention.
Advanced LiftMaster gate openers are equipped to display diagnostic error codes, signaling precise malfunctions within the system. These codes can indicate anything from motor overcurrent protection to sensor failures, requiring a knowledgeable technician to accurately interpret and rectify the root cause.
